Biol 205: week 10-11, lecture 29-lecture 30 (beginning of lecture 30) In 2003 the human genome project completed an initial draft sequence of the human genome after ~13 years and a cumulative cost of ~ million. 2003 sh. 10/base: costs dropped sharply over the course of project due to improvements in sequencing technology especially replacing gels with capillary electrophoresis. 600 bp of sequence possible in each run.
